I've found myself frequently wanting at least ONE and ZERO values from
num_traits, so I took a shot at implementing them here (this required implementingMulas well).I know there was some discussion/hesitation about implementing
num_traitshere, but this was so long ago now I'm thinking perhaps the concerns are no longer relevant.I did put the feature behind a flag and defaulted
num_traitsto not usingstdto maintain that aspect ofuX.
